General description

Dynasore is a small molecule GTPase inhibitor that targets dynamin-1, dynamin-2 and Drp1 (mitochondrial). Dynasore blocks dynamin-dependent endocytosis, scission of endocytic vesicles. Dynosore is profibrotic, induces PAI-1 in pleural mesothelial cells, and may be an effective pleurodesing (pleurodesis) agent. Dynasor blocks human papillomavirus type 16 (HPV16) and bovine papillomavirus type 1 (BPV1) (pseudovirions) infections.
Dynasore hydrate lowers labile cholesterol in the plasma membrane and distorts lipid raft organization.[1] Dynasore exhibits pleotropic effects on herpes simplex virus (HSV)-1 and HSV-2 infection. It hinders viral entry, trafficking of viral proteins and capsid formation.[2]

Biochem/physiol Actions

Dynasore is a cell-permeable, reversible noncompetitive dynamin 1 and dynamin 2 GTPase activity inhibitor.

  1. What concentration of Product D7693, Dynasore hydrate, should I use in my experiment?

    1 answer
    1. The following reference uses Dynasore at 80 μM:  Massol, R.H., et al., A burst of auxilin recruitment determines the onset of clathrin-coated vesicle uncoating.  Proc. Nat. Acad. Sci., USA, 103, 10265-10270 (2006).

  2. How can I store a solution of Product D7693, Dynasore hydrate?

    1 answer
    1. We do not test solution stability for this product. In general, drug solutions are best prepared immediately before use.  We recommend storing at -20°C in single use aliquots.
